Weather in July

July, the same as June, in Head of Island, Louisiana, is another tropical summer month, with an average temperature ranging between min 74.1°F (23.4°C) and max 91°F (32.8°C).

Temperature

Head of Island experiences its highest average temperatures in July, reaching a peak of 91°F (32.8°C) and a minimum of 74.1°F (23.4°C).

Heat index

The heat index in July is evaluated at a blazing hot 116.6°F (47°C). Be on the lookout: Heat cramps and heat exhaustion are anticipated. Continued exertion can result in heatstroke.
Understanding the heat index involves considering values for shaded locales with light wind. Exposing to direct sunshine may enhance heat index values by 15 Fahrenheit (8 Celsius) degrees.
Note: The heat index, also known as 'apparent temperature' or 'feels like', is an estimation of the warmth sensation when considering humidity levels. This impact is subjective, influenced by the person's physical activity and individual heat perception, affected by factors including wind, attire, and metabolic differences. Always consider that direct sunlight exposure might heighten the heat's effects, pushing the heat index up by 15 Fahrenheit (8 Celsius) degrees. Heat index values are primarily vital for children. Juveniles are regularly less conscious of the need to recuperate and rehydrate. Thirst is a tardy symptom of dehydration - hydration, especially during lengthy physical activities, should be maintained.
To offset high temperatures, the human body releases sweat which, upon evaporation, cools it down. With excessive moisture in the atmosphere, the effectiveness of the evaporation process is decreased, causing the body to cool down less efficiently, leading to a sensation of overheating. When the body is unable to balance heat gain, its temperature elevates, which may induce thermal illnesses.

Humidity

In Head of Island, the average relative humidity in July is 79%.

Rainfall

The month with the most rainfall in Head of Island is July, when the rain falls for 18.9 days and typically aggregates up to 3.03" (77mm) of precipitation.

Snowfall

In Head of Island, snow does not fall in February through December.

Daylight

The average length of the day in July in Head of Island, Louisiana, is 13h and 52min.
On the first day of July in Head of Island, sunrise is at 6:05 am and sunset at 8:08 pm. On the last day of the month, sunrise is at 6:21 am and sunset at 7:57 pm CDT.

Sunshine

The average sunshine in July in Head of Island is 10.3h.

UV index

The months with the highest UV index in Head of Island are May through August, with an average maximum UV index of 7. A UV Index of 6 to 7 symbolizes a high health vulnerability from unsafe exposure to UV radiation for the average person.
Note: The maximum daily UV index of 7 in July converts into the following recommendations:
Shield from overexposure. Defense against sun-related harm is required. Attempt to stay under shade and limit exposure to the Sun between 10 a.m. and 4 p.m., when UV radiation is at its peak. Remember, devices such as parasols or canopies might not provide complete sun protection. Outfit yourself in sun-safe attire, like long sleeves, pants, a hat, and UV-blocking sunglasses.
